You are currently viewing 5 Best CSS Frameworks for Modern Web Development

5 Best CSS Frameworks for Modern Web Development

Share this to everyone:

Cascading Style Sheets (CSS) are the cornerstone of web design, enabling developers to control the visual presentation of websites and applications. While CSS is a powerful tool on its own, CSS frameworks have gained immense popularity for simplifying and streamlining the process of building responsive, aesthetically pleasing, and consistent web interfaces. In this article, we will explore five of the best CSS frameworks that have been widely adopted by developers for modern web development.

Bootstrap

Bootstrap is perhaps the most well-known CSS framework, developed by Twitter and now maintained by the open-source community. It offers a comprehensive set of pre-designed UI components, responsive grid layouts, and a wide range of customization options. Bootstrap is beginner-friendly, and its extensive documentation makes it easy for developers to get started. With Bootstrap, you can create responsive and mobile-first websites with ease.

Key Features:

  • A robust grid system.
  • Extensive library of UI components.
  • Responsive design by default.
  • Flexibility for customization.
  • Large community support and third-party plugins.

CDN Link:

<link
  rel="stylesheet"
  href="https://cdn.jsdelivr.net/npm/bootstrap@5.3.0/dist/css/bootstrap.min.css"
/>

Foundation

Foundation, created by ZURB, is another popular CSS framework known for its flexibility and customization options. It provides a responsive grid system and a rich collection of CSS and JavaScript components to help developers build modern, responsive web applications. Foundation is highly modular, allowing developers to pick and choose only the components they need for their projects.

Key Features:

  • Highly customizable and modular.
  • Mobile-first approach.
  • Comprehensive set of responsive design tools.
  • Support for Sass, a CSS preprocessor.
  • Accessibility-focused design.

CDN Link

<link
  rel="stylesheet"
  href="https://cdn.jsdelivr.net/npm/foundation-sites@6.7.0/dist/css/foundation.min.css"
/>

TailWind

Tailwind CSS is a utility-first CSS framework that takes a unique approach to styling web applications. Instead of providing pre-designed components, Tailwind CSS offers a set of utility classes that can be used to style HTML elements. This framework allows developers to create highly customized designs with minimal CSS code. It has gained popularity for its simplicity and developer-friendly approach.

Key Features:

  • Utility-first approach.

  • Highly customizable with easy theming.

  • Rapid development with concise HTML classes.

  • Built-in support for responsive design.

  • Extensive community and ecosystem.
CDN Link:

<link rel="stylesheet" href="https://cdn.jsdelivr.net/npm/tailwindcss@2.2.19/dist/tailwind.min.css" />

Bulma

Bulma is a lightweight and modern CSS framework that focuses on simplicity and minimalism. It provides a clean and intuitive syntax, making it easy for developers to create responsive and attractive web interfaces. Bulma’s modular structure and responsive grid system make it a great choice for both beginners and experienced developers.

Key Features:

  • Minimalistic and clean design.

  • Responsive grid system.

  • Easy-to-read documentation.

  • Flexbox-based layout.Customizable with Sass variables.
CDN Link:

<link rel="stylesheet" href="https://cdn.jsdelivr.net/npm/bulma@0.9.3/css/bulma.min.css" />

Semantic UI:

Semantic UI is a framework that emphasizes the use of semantic HTML markup to create intuitive and responsive user interfaces. It offers a wide range of UI components and themes, making it suitable for projects of all sizes. Semantic UI promotes consistency and readability in code by encouraging the use of meaningful class names.

Key Features:

  • Emphasis on semantic HTML.

  • Extensive library of UI elements.

  • Theming support.Community-driven development.

  • Easy-to-follow naming conventions.
CDN Link:

<link rel="stylesheet" href="https://cdn.jsdelivr.net/npm/semantic-ui@2.4.2/dist/semantic.min.css" />

Conclusion:

Choosing the right CSS framework depends on the specific requirements of your web development project, your coding preferences, and your team’s expertise. Each of these five CSS frameworks mentioned in this article has its strengths and can help streamline your development process, improve code maintainability, and create visually appealing, responsive web interfaces. Experiment with these frameworks to find the one that best suits your needs and style as a developer.